From: Dmitry Torokhov <dtor_core@ameritech.net>

synaptics driver cleanup

- pack all button data in 2 bytes instead of 48

- adjust the way we extract button data

- query extended capabilities if SYN_EXT_CAP_REQUESTS >= 1 (was == 1)
  according to Synaptics' addendum to the interfacing guide

- do not announce or report BTN_BACK/BTN_FORWARD unless touchpad has
  SYN_CAP_FOUR_BUTTON in its capability flags
